进销存系统是一种管理企业库存和销售的软件,它可以帮助管理者实时了解库存情况,预测销售趋势,优化库存水平,减少库存积压和缺货风险。开发进销存系统需要以下技术人员资质:
1. 计算机科学与技术专业背景:开发人员需要具备扎实的计算机科学基础知识,包括数据结构、算法、操作系统、网络等。这些知识是开发进销存系统的基础。
2. 数据库技术:开发人员需要熟悉关系型数据库(如MySQL、Oracle等)和非关系型数据库(如MongoDB、Redis等)。他们需要能够设计和管理数据库,确保数据的完整性和一致性。
3. 编程语言:开发人员需要熟练掌握一种或多种编程语言,如Java、Python、C#等。这些语言是开发进销存系统的主要工具。
4. 软件开发方法论:开发人员需要了解软件开发的生命周期,包括需求分析、设计、编码、测试和维护等阶段。这有助于他们在开发过程中遵循最佳实践,提高代码质量。
5. 软件工程知识:开发人员需要具备软件工程的基本概念,如软件设计模式、软件架构、软件测试等。这些知识有助于他们在开发过程中更好地组织代码,提高系统的可维护性和可扩展性。
6. 项目管理能力:开发人员需要具备一定的项目管理能力,如制定项目计划、分配任务、监控进度等。这有助于他们在开发过程中更好地协调各方资源,确保项目按时完成。
7. 商业智能和数据分析技能:随着市场竞争的加剧,企业越来越重视对市场和销售数据的分析和挖掘。开发人员需要具备一定的商业智能和数据分析技能,以便在进销存系统中实现对这些数据的实时监控和分析。
8. 用户体验设计:开发人员需要关注用户的需求和体验,确保进销存系统界面友好、操作简便。这有助于提高用户的使用满意度,降低系统的使用难度。
9. 持续学习和创新精神:技术领域不断发展,新的技术和工具层出不穷。开发人员需要具备持续学习和创新的精神,不断更新自己的知识和技能,以适应不断变化的技术环境。
10. 团队合作与沟通能力:进销存系统的开发通常需要多个部门协同合作,如销售、采购、财务等。开发人员需要具备良好的团队合作精神和沟通能力,以便在项目中有效地与各方沟通和协作。
总之,开发进销存系统需要具备计算机科学与技术、数据库技术、编程语言、软件开发方法论、软件工程知识、项目管理能力、商业智能和数据分析技能、用户体验设计以及持续学习和创新精神等多方面的技术人员资质。只有具备这些资质的技术人员才能开发出高效、稳定、易用的进销存系统,帮助企业实现库存管理和销售管理的自动化。